Evolution of Esports

Esports, short for electronic sports, refers to competitive video gaming where individuals or teams battle against each other in various games. What started as an underground subculture has now become a global phenomenon, captivating millions of fans worldwide.

From Basements to Arenas

The journey of esports can be traced back to local gaming competitions held in basements and community centers. Today, esports events pack arenas, with prize pools exceeding millions of dollars.

Convergence of Gaming and Entertainment

One of the key factors driving the growth of esports is the convergence of gaming and entertainment. Esports events are no longer just about the competition; they are entertainment extravaganzas, complete with concerts.

Trends Shaping the Industry

  • Rise of Mobile Esports: With the increasing popularity of mobile gaming, mobile esports has seen a significant rise, attracting a new audience demographic.
  • Inclusion of Non-Endemic Brands: Esports organizations are partnering with companies outside the gaming industry, opening up new avenues for sponsorship and revenue.
  • Exploring Virtual Reality Gaming Tournaments: As technology advances, the potential for virtual reality esports is being explored, offering a new dimension to competitive gaming.
